2. What Zedlayby does
Zedlayby is a discovery and management platform. We connect shoppers with retailers who offer layby plans. We check that plans meet the legal requirements of Zambia's Hire-Purchase Act (Cap 399). We help generate written agreements.
We are not a party to any layby agreement. The agreement is always between you (the shopper) and the retailer. We do not lend money, hold payments, or guarantee the goods or services being sold.

4. For shoppers
When you apply for a layby, you are making a request to the retailer. The retailer decides whether to approve your application. Once approved, both you and the retailer are bound by the terms of the written agreement generated on the platform.
Your rights under the Hire-Purchase Act (Cap 399) apply to every agreement made through Zedlayby — including your right to a written agreement, your right to pay off early, and your right to terminate under certain conditions. You can learn more on our Shopper Rights page.

7. Disputes between shoppers and retailers
Zedlayby is not a mediator or arbitrator. If a dispute arises between a shopper and a retailer, we encourage both parties to resolve it directly. You may also contact the Zambia Competition and Consumer Protection Commission (ZCCPC) for guidance on your rights.
